How much does an Certified Orthopedic Casting Technician make in Lincoln, NE? The average Certified Orthopedic Casting Technician salary in Lincoln, NE is $47,800 as of May 28, 2024, but the range typically falls between $42,300 and $54,700. Salary ranges can vary widely depending on many important factors, including education, certifications, additional skills, the number of years you have spent in your profession. Job Description

The Certified Orthopedic Casting Technician sets up bed traction units or rigs special devices as required, and inspects and adjusts bandages and equipment. Applies and adjusts plaster casts and assembles and attaches orthopedic traction equipment and devices as directed by a physician. Being a Certified Orthopedic Casting Technician typically reports to a supervisor or manager. Requires a high school diploma or its equivalent, completion of Orthopedic Technician training and certification program. Certified Orthopedic Casting Technician's years of experience requirement may be unspecified. Certification and/or licensing in the position's specialty is the main requirement. These charts show the average base salary (core compensation), as well as the average total cash compensation for the job of Certified Orthopedic Casting Technician in Lincoln, NE. The base salary for Certified Orthopedic Casting Technician ranges from $42,300 to $54,700 with the average base salary of $47,800. The total cash compensation, which includes base, and annual incentives, can vary anywhere from $42,600 to $54,800 with the average total cash compensation of $47,900.
